Transaction 681adda05527eae58e2f074e5429e7a29336842f5432164790eb8e0f9418b0a2

1 Input
2 Outputs
  • 681adda05527eae58e2f074e5429e7a29336842f5432164790eb8e0f9418b0a2:0
  • value  37649348139
    address  2NGRBjecWze6aA1ic6tKc55uFEvPoJLN1BV
  • 681adda05527eae58e2f074e5429e7a29336842f5432164790eb8e0f9418b0a2:1
  • value  1420031
    address  2N2sThgVTbyaSHfjj6UpsL7gZB9rokaTo3Z